Address

VmFM3tLX4uf3DcJvjevH7FN96aE23NN5F2

0 VIA

Confirmed
Total Received760.88368737 VIA1.91 VEF
Total Sent760.88368737 VIA1.91 VEF
Final Balance0 VIA0.00 VEF
No. Transactions2

Transactions

VmFM3tLX4uf3DcJvjevH7FN96aE23NN5F2760.88368737 VIA51980845.04 VEF1.91 VEF
 
VwPzZpWBMgbr8jX8Y6U5gXLZVVBoiQAmL60.10009066 VIA6837.83 VEF0.00 VEF
Vpv1djXxJ6AmCLqKRemgu8XJFDsdRMopKh0.10116077 VIA6910.94 VEF0.00 VEF×
Vnj5hkXcPCWSGqMDEhXBe4vrjhVd1VzSHh760.68191594 VIA51967060.74 VEF1.91 VEF
ViF9LGtxtosPvh4v8jAJ4h52QJCnDce1b1760.99388418 VIA51988373.29 VEF1.91 VEF
 
VmFM3tLX4uf3DcJvjevH7FN96aE23NN5F2760.88368737 VIA51980845.04 VEF1.91 VEF
VgPrAL8JFTjNcHPCviWnnSnRMHhgrEgvrW0.10974481 VIA7497.37 VEF0.00 VEF